Step 1: Define Your Kitchen's Purpose

Decide how you will use your kitchen. Is the kitchen primarily used for entertaining or cooking? Take into account your lifestyle and how many people use the kitchen regularly.

Your design decisions will be guided by this understanding, which ensures that the layout, appliances, and storage meet your needs. A family-oriented space might be prioritized by seating and open space while a gourmet chef may prefer high-end appliances or ample counter space.

Step 3: Set a Budget

The costs of the outdoor kitchen should be defined clearly at the beginning of your project. George says that your budget will determine how far you can take your wishlist. 

You need to determine how much money you can spend realistically on your project. Include plumbing, wiring and lighting, appliances, and flooring, as well as any other costs. Add an additional 10% to your budget as a contingency in case of unforeseen expenses.

Step 4: Create a Detailed Floor Plan

Start your design a kitchen on paper using an accurate scale to see how it will appear. Include windows and doors in your plans, as they will influence where you can place appliances and other items. 

It’s helpful to divide the kitchen plan into different zones if you plan to have an open-plan project. To find the best locations for kitchen faucets and appliances, you should cut out accurate representations. 

It will be easier to experiment with different layouts and configurations without having to erase and redraw your plan. It can also be helpful when it comes time to budget. You will have a better idea of what you can spend on new appliances.

Step 7: Choose the Kitchen Materials

Hardwood and plywood work well for rustic, traditional designs. Engineered wood, also known as fibreboard, offers a smoother surface with a minimal appearance. It is available in many different colours.

Natural wood can be more expensive and requires extra maintenance. However, this adds real value to your kitchen table. Engineered wood, on the other hand, is less expensive and easier to keep.

Step 10: Good Lighting

Lighting creates an atmosphere in the kitchen and illuminates the entire cooking area. A welcoming atmosphere is created by good lighting. Be creative when mixing feature lights.

From dimmable ceiling lighting to task lighting beneath cabinets, track lighting, and striking pendant fixtures. This style looks like America’s test kitchen.
